Andrés Velasco

Andrés Velasco is a distinguished economist and former Finance Minister of Chile, his home country. Currently Tinker Visiting Professor at the Columbia School of International and Public Affairs, Professor Velasco has also served as Sumitomo-Fasid Professor of International Finance and Development at the Kennedy School of Government at Harvard University. He has been an advisor to the governments of Colombia, Ecuador, El Salvador, Nigeria, South Africa and Kazakhstan,  as well as a consultant to the World Bank, the International Monetary Fund, the Inter-American Development Bank, the UN Economic Commission for Latin America, and the Federal Reserve Bank of Atlanta.
Professor Velasco's role as Senior Academic Advisor will include developing plans for the School’s future case-study centre, as well as teaching and advising on the School’s curriculum and overall development.
